NBA Superstar Shaquille O'Neal Is The New Owner and Global Spokesperson of Krispy Kreme

NBA legend and hall of famer, Shaquille O'neal has embarked a new business venture as his love for donuts made him a proud owner of a Krispy Kreme store in downtown Atlanta.

It is safe to say that one of the most dominant big men in the NBA, Shaq, is not just all about basketball, but is also going all-in as a businessman of his own. With him owning a store, the giant will be the global spokesperson for the brand as well.

According to news posted in Fortune.com, the Krispy Kreme store that Shaq bought is located at Ponce De Leon Avenue. This is considered historical, as the donut shop has been around the said location for more than 60 years.

In the same article, he said, "Krispy Kreme prides itself on spreading joy and supporting local communities..." He adds, "That's a cause that I am thrilled to be a part of."

With Shaq's big takeover as an owner, the donut company will offer a social media campaign this Halloween called "Shaq-or-Treat." The promotional campaign will give customers a chance to win Shaq-autographed merchandise or some "Krispy Kreme surprises" if they post on social media with the hashtag #ShaqOrTreat between October 28-31, as said on the same website.

No less than the president and CEO of Krispy Kreme Doughnuts, Tony Thompson has expressed his excitement about this. In his speech, "We are confident this partnership will have a big impact for us in Atlanta and around the world."
